A few months back I picked up an R6000 multi-band antenna so I could get onto a few of the HF bands. Time constraints and weather have prevented me from putting up the antenna - until this past weekend. We had a nice, spring like day so up it went. Obviously, since the antenna has only been up for a couple of days I can't give a review, but so far I'm liking it. Yesterday afternoon I decided to give the new antenna a try. On 15m I made a contact with KL7LF Joe in Fairbanks, Alaska. Spun the dial and made contact with JE1RXJ 'Tack' in Hiratsuka City, Japan. Then I dropped back down frequency a little and made contact with JA8ECS 'Kazu' in Sapporo, Japan. My 'fish finder' indicated activity up the band a few khz so I let a little line out of my reel and made a contact with JO7CVU 'Ken' in Sendai City, Japan. All reports were 59 with excellent copy on both ends. I'm running a 756 ProII @ 50% power (about 50w pep) into the R6000 @ approx. 25 feet.
